Instructor applicants have rated the interview process at SIUE with 3 out of 5 (where 5 is the highest level of difficulty) and assessed their interview experience as 100% positive. To compare, the company-average is 87.5% positive. This is according to Glassdoor user ratings.
Candidates applying for Instructor roles take an average of 7 days to get hired, when considering 2 user submitted interviews for this role. To compare, the hiring process at SIUE overall takes an average of 25 days.

Multiple interviews with various team members ; no surprises in types of questions; several applicants available to each open position; not much pay negotiation in process; very informal overall; difficult to get initial interview due to high applicant pool

I applied through an employee referral. The process took 1 week. I interviewed at SIUE (Edwardsville, IL)
Interview
Informal meeting to ensure fit, skills, and expertise in subject matter. Very quick process. Interviewer very friendly and informative regarding position and program. Shown office and work space, very conversational approach. 1:1 interview with Chair, introduced to colleagues later.
